A charter school is more than just an educational institution; it is a nurturing environment where every child can thrive. These schools are designed to provide innovative approaches to learning, often free from the bureaucratic constraints of traditional public schools. This flexibility allows charter schools to create diverse programs that cater to a wide range of learning styles and interests.

The curriculum in charter schools is often designed with flexibility in mind. Educators have the freedom to explore innovative teaching methods that resonate with their students. Whether it’s incorporating project-based learning, technology integration, or hands-on activities, the goal remains the same: to engage and inspire. This approach not only makes learning enjoyable but also helps students develop critical thinking skills and a love for lifelong learning.

As we consider the holistic development of a child, the importance of social-emotional learning becomes clear. Charter schools often prioritize this aspect by integrating programs that promote emotional intelligence, resilience, and interpersonal skills. Through activities such as group discussions, conflict resolution exercises, and mindfulness practices, children learn how to navigate their emotions and build healthy relationships with their peers. This foundation is crucial for their overall well-being and future success.
